Lecturers from the Forestry Department of the University of Bengkulu Develop Maggot Cultivation to Reduce Campus Organic Waste

Bengkulu—December 30, 2025, the University of Bengkulu continues to demonstrate its commitment to supporting environmental sustainability through the UI GreenMetric program. One concrete effort is being implemented through maggot cultivation activities initiated by lecturers from the Forestry Department as a solution for managing organic waste on campus. Campus Natural Cycle: Litter Recycling Movement to Create Fertile Soil at the University of Bengkulu

Bengkulu, November 21, 2025 — The Forestry Department of the University of Bengkulu initiated an environmental movement titled “Campus Natural Cycle: Litter Recycling Movement to Create Fertile Soil” as an effort to utilize the abundant dry leaf litter on campus. Compost Harvesting from Dry Leaf Litter at the Forestry Department, University of Bengkulu

Bengkulu, November 14, 2025 — The Department of Forestry, University of Bengkulu, conducted a compost harvesting activity from dry leaf litter in the department’s nursery area.
